Framework for Computer-Aided Evolution of Object-Oriented Designs


Share/Save/Bookmark

Ciraci, Selim and Broek, Pim van den and Aksit, Mehmet (2008) Framework for Computer-Aided Evolution of Object-Oriented Designs. In: 32nd Annual IEEE International Computer Software and Applications Conference 2008, July 28 - August 1, 2008, Turku, Finland (pp. pp. 757-764).

[img] PDF
Restricted to UT campus only
: Request a copy
453kB
Abstract:In this paper, we describe a framework for the computer-aided evolution of the designs of object-oriented software systems. Evolution mechanisms are software structures that prepare software for certain type of evolutions. The framework uses a database which holds the evolution mechanisms, modeled as template graph transformations, with the supported evolution types. To evolve the software, the designer enters the type of evolution and provides the names of the software entities that are going to be evolved. The framework fetches the evolution mechanisms, converts the design to a graph model and applies the transformations. As an application of the framework, we implemented a tool for computer-aided evolution that uses object-oriented evolution mechanisms
Item Type:Conference or Workshop Item
Copyright:© 2008 IEEE
Faculty:
Electrical Engineering, Mathematics and Computer Science (EEMCS)
Research Group:
Link to this item:http://purl.utwente.nl/publications/60217
Official URL:http://dx.doi.org/10.1109/COMPSAC.2008.46
Export this item as:BibTeX
EndNote
HTML Citation
Reference Manager

 

Repository Staff Only: item control page

Metis ID: 251109